(H)GWBEB type outdoor high-voltage isolation switch, popularly known as an isolation disconnect switch, is the epitome of advanced design for utilization on high voltage power transmission and distribution lines ranging from 10(12, 15, 24)kV. This remarkable switch is engineered to seamlessly open and close single-phase or three-phase circuits without load while the voltage is present, ensuring optimal performance and reliability.
Intended for single-phase use within three-phase line systems, the switch stands out with its straightforward structure, cost-efficiency, and user-friendly operation. Available in rated currents of 200, 400, 600, 800, 1000, and 1250 amps, these switches are comprised of a robust base, sturdy post insulators, high-quality conductive parts, and a mechanical section engineered for excellence. The innovative gate knife structure is employed for circuit operations, featuring two conductive blades per phase and external compression springs for precise contact pressure. Operable with an insulated hook stick and equipped with a self-locking device, this switch embodies both functionality and safety.
Working Environment:
Altitude not exceeding 1000 meters;
Ambient temperature: maximum not above +40°C; minimum not below -30°C;
Outdoor wind speed not exceeding 35 meters/second;
Seismic intensity not exceeding 8 degrees; the installation site should be free from frequent severe vibrations to ensure durability and performance.
The installation location must be devoid of gases, chemical deposits, salt mist, dust, dirt, or any other explosive or corrosive mediums that could severely impact the switch's insulation and conductivity.

Installation, Use and Adjustment
Pre-installation work
Conduct an annual thorough inspection of the following switch components to ensure longevity and reliability:
Meticulously cleanse dirt from conductive parts, contact surfaces, and the insulating porcelain bottle's surface to maintain optimal conductivity.
Examine all components for potential damage, placing particular emphasis on inspecting the insulating porcelain bottle for any damage or cracks.
Assess the conductive part's contact surface to ensure it remains in optimal condition for peak performance.
